Women's Sports Services teams up
with African American Women in Technology


HUNTINGTON BEACH, CA. (August 12, 2004). Women's Sports Services, LLC (WSS), a career development and diversity recruitment company that operates the online career center WomenSportJobs.com, has announced a partnership with the African American Women in Technology (AAWIT). The partnership will focus on diversity hiring needs in the sports and entertainment industries. Both organizations will provide additional support to promote women of color interested in sports and technology related careers.

The African-American Women in Technology organization (AAWIT) is a non-profit organization dedicated to the education, support and advancement of African-American women in the field of Information Technology. AAWIT encourages, promotes and serves the interest(s) of African-American women in Information Technology, striving to help its members advance their careers and enhance their personal development through special resources and networking opportunities. AAWIT.net is an informative, educational, resourceful, online community and is research, quality and community oriented

"The synergy between AAWIT and WSS will give our members the opportunity to use their technology skills to explore career opportunities in the sports industry. This gives them an even greater opportunity to enhance their lives and the lives of their families," said Monique Boea, president and founder of the African American Women in Technology (AAWIT).

"The significant alliance will provide our employer partners a great reach of qualified women with expertise in technology fields and ensure that AAWIT members have increased career opportunities in non-traditional fields, said Mary Lou Youngblood, Chief Operating Officer, Women's Sports Services.

Through the partnership both groups will work to cross promote services and offerings. In addition, members of the African American Women in Technology (AAWIT) will have access to a comprehensive online career center including job listings, resume support, career development seminars and networking events. "We are proud to support the African American Women in Technology (AAWIT) and we look forward to working together to ensure diversity hiring in sports," said Becky Heidesch, CEO, Women's Sports Services, LLC. 

Overview of Women's Sports Services, LLC
Women's Sports Services, founded in 1995, has done a variety of work in the active women's market in the areas of women's sports marketing and career development. In 2002, the company decided to concentrate its efforts solely on career development and recruiting.
